# Order-cutoff rule for the Crumbline bakery backend.
# Orders placed after 14:00 local time roll to the next baking day.
# Holiday overrides live in the cutoff_exceptions table and must be
# loaded before each release. The cutoff scheduler reads all of this
# from the orders database via the connection string below.

replica DSN, kajep-yahag: mssql://praok_svc:iF@db-8d68.plorvaio.local:5432/eliion

## Inventory Write-Down — Managers Only

Following the annual count at the Dunhollow warehouse, we are recording a write-down on obsolete Ferrow-line stock. Sales leads should remove affected SKUs from active quotes and steer customers toward the Ferrow II range. Margin targets remain unchanged for now. The confidential guidance on forward planning appears directly below.

confidential, hadup-yaguf: Briielox Systems plans to raise the Holax list price by 5 percent in July.

Subject: Handover — SnackRoute restock planner DB

Hi Torvald,

As discussed, I'm handing over the SnackRoute planner database before I rotate to the billing team. Nightly restock forecasts run at 02:15 and write to the `route_plans` table; if they fail, re-run the `replan` job manually. Backups go to cold storage weekly. The only credential you need day one is for the primary planner instance, which connects via the string below.

primary connection of tajeg-tajop = postgresql://julax_svc:DI@db-e7f3.kelvidyn.corp:5432/rusdor